Kuhn presents solutions for nutrition and forage at Agroleite.

Company highlights 45 m³ industrial mixer with three vertical screws and combinations of balers and packaging machines.

A leader in livestock equipment, Kuhn do Brasil is showcasing at Agroleite a portfolio focused on one of the most sensitive pillars of dairy farming: nutritional efficiency and forage conservation. In a sector where feed quality directly impacts herd productivity and health, the multinational's innovations at the event stand out for ensuring high operational durability, recipe precision, and fiber preservation.

The solutions that will be on display at the trade fair from August 3rd to 7th range from industrial-scale mixers to advanced bale sealing systems that can be done in seconds.

Industrial mixing standard: Euromix 45.3 CL

One of the brand's highlights for large producers and feedlots is the Euromix 45.3 CL, a high-capacity total mixed ration (TMR) mixer. Designed for demanding operations, the equipment features three continuously driven vertical mixing augers and an effective capacity of 45 m³, capable of feeding up to 360 dairy cows in a single pass. 

The model comes equipped with a transverse distribution conveyor (CL version) that features 250 mm of lateral hydraulic displacement on both sides. This system extends the discharge reach into the feed bunk and prevents the tractor tires from rolling over the feed. To ensure total diet precision, the equipment has an independent chassis equipped with 6 load cells and the advanced DTM Advance Cloud / Kuhn Datamix weighing system, allowing recipe management and monitoring directly from a smartphone or tablet. 

The equipment's durability is ensured by the reinforced hopper roof and the option of K-NOX stainless steel lining, which protects the structure against mechanical wear and the acidity of silage. The transmission features a two-speed gearbox to facilitate starting under load with less tractor power required. 

Automotive technology: SPV line

For properties requiring maximum maneuverability and agility, Kuhn showcases the SPV Power line, comprised of self-propelled vertical screw mixer wagons with capacities ranging from 12 to 17 m³. Compact and with an "all-purpose" concept, they are equipped with a 167 hp JDSP engine regulated with variable speed for fuel economy.

  • Version differences: the Power version offers greater cutting power (120 hp) and traction, while the Intense version offers a road speed of 40 km/h, a raised chassis, and reinforced front wheels for fast travel.
  • Ergonomics and visibility: the Visiospace cabin comes with a pneumatic seat, multifunctional joystick, VTI 60 screen and a monitoring system with 4 cameras integrated into a 7” monitor, offering a complete view of the rear, the mixture and the unloading process.
  • Nutritional performance: features the DG 8000-iC programmable electronic weighing system, which enables rigorous control of recipe formulation, batch-based ingredient management, and high traceability in food processing.

Perfect bales in seconds: VBP line

With a focus on forage conservation (silage, pre-dried forage and hay), Kuhn presents its combined solutions of round balers and wrappers, designed to seal the bale in seconds to prevent loss of nutritional value.

  • VBP 3200 Series (Variable Chamber): merging the renowned VB 3260 variable chamber balers (with Opticut integral rotor) with an intelligent baling system, plus 3D baling and the Intelliwrap system, guarantees perfectly sealed bales at a low cost. Operational control is performed via the Process Visualization interface using an Isobus terminal.
  • VBP 7100 Series (High Performance): The VBP 7160 model stands out for producing the highest density straw bales on the market. With a patented i-Dense density regulation system, it perfectly handles short and wet silages. The machine features an intake system for up to 33 knives, an optional Kuhn Twin film tying system, a reinforced BalePack chassis, and extra-large tandem wheels, ensuring high durability and performance in the highest class of combined balers.
